Project Background & Objectives

The WAPG 120 MW Power Plant project was initiated as a flagship utility-scale power infrastructure development to critically expand reliable generation capacity and support long-term economic development in Freetown, Sierra Leone. Commissioned by Sargent & Lundy, this landmark high-efficiency facility involves constructing a state-of-the-art Combined Cycle Power Plant based on 2x SGT-750 Gas Turbines and 1x 43.32 MW STG Steam Turbine to supply steady baseload power to the regional transmission grid. Within this highly sophisticated thermal generation framework, PDP Energy was selected to protect the project’s technical and structural integrity. The primary company-specific objectives focus on fulfilling the comprehensive role of Site owner engineer for civil, mechanical, electrical, and instrumentation trades, providing rigorous field quality assurance across all engineering disciplines.
